News about Lemonbomb Entertainment (Developer) Games

Stranded Sails header

Stranded Sails Finding Their Way to PC and Consoles Soon

Are you ready to no longer be stranded? Good news then, as Stranded Sails - Explorers of the Cursed Islands will be launching on PC and consoles quite soon. Billing itself as The Legend of…

October 4, 2019 | 03:45 EDT